§ 33-1705 — Notice posted in the office

Arizona·Title 33 Arizona Revised Statutes·Ch. 15 SELF-SERVICE STORAGE·Art. 1 General Provisions
Each operator acting pursuant to this article shall at all times keep posted in a prominent place in the operator's office or on the premises of the self-service storage facility, a notice that reads as follows: Articles stored pursuant to a rental agreement may be sold or disposed of if any storage charges are overdue for more than thirty days.
